Due to the unfolding COVID-19 pandemic, the World Rowing Federation cancelled all international events for 2024 on 9 April 2024, some time after the 2024 Summer Olympics and Summer Paralympics had been postponed by one year. … argan sublimeWeb17 jul. 2024 · Henley Royal is unique on the international rowing circuit. Unlike the Olympics and World Championships which are held on six-lane 2000 metre still-water courses, races at Henley are head-to-head gladiatorial contests on an upstream course over 1 mile 550 yards - or 2112 metres - of the rural river Thames. argantWeb12 aug. 2024 · Henley Rowing Club (last champions in 2005) for their form this season and The Tideway Scullers’ School are the dark horses.
